She also received Emmy Awards for Outstanding Single Hard News Story for Smuggled from China, which exposed the horrific plights of Chinese refugees from the Golden Venture ship, and for her live coverage of the snowstorm of 1994. Her most poignant story was the two-part series Bringing Rosie Home. Through home videos, she brought viewers to China as she adopted her daughter, Rosie, as a single mother. Cindy served as President of the New York Chapter of the Asian American Journalists Association, and paddled for years on a championship Dragon Boating team called Women in Canoe.
